When troubleshooting AC issues in your Plymouth Acclaim, it's essential to adopt a methodical diagnostic approach. Start with a visual inspection of the air conditioning system to identify any obvious signs of wear or damage. Next, check the refrigerant levels to ensure they are within the proper range, as low refrigerant can lead to inadequate cooling. If the refrigerant is low, use a sniffer to detect any leaks, particularly of CFC gas, which can indicate a more significant problem. Additionally, test the heater controls to confirm that air is directed correctly across the evaporator and that the heater core is sealed off when not in use. Inspect the compressor and its components, including the clutch plate and belt tension, as these are critical for proper AC operation. If you notice any slipping, consider swapping the compressor relay with another in the fuse box to rule out electrical issues. By following these steps, you can effectively diagnose and address AC problems, ensuring your Plymouth Acclaim remains comfortable during hot weather.
When dealing with AC failure in a Plymouth Acclaim, it's essential to understand the common problems that may be at play. One of the most frequent culprits is low refrigerant, often caused by leaks in the system, which can significantly hinder the AC's performance. Additionally, pitted contacts within the electrical system can lead to voltage drops, affecting the clutch coil's ability to engage properly. HVAC system issues may also arise, particularly when the vehicle experiences heavy engine loads, causing it to inadvertently switch to defrost mode; this can often be remedied by installing a vacuum check valve. Electrical problems are another area to investigate, as faulty wiring or components can disrupt the climate control system's functionality. Furthermore, a malfunctioning speed sensor can impact the overall operation of the AC system, making it crucial to ensure this component is working correctly. Lastly, be vigilant for leaks in hoses or seals, as these can lead to refrigerant loss and subsequent AC failure. By addressing these common issues, DIYers can effectively troubleshoot and restore the AC system in their Plymouth Acclaim.
